濕地公園岸帶空間設(shè)計研究
發(fā)布時間:2019-03-25 21:37
【摘要】:濕地公園是近年來興起的一種濕地保護(hù)與綜合利用協(xié)調(diào)發(fā)展新型模式,其設(shè)計理論與實踐尚不完善。目前在濕地公園岸帶空間設(shè)計中,較多的沿用了園林景觀水體的設(shè)計思路,造成了濕地植物種類匱乏、岸帶物質(zhì)與能量交流不暢、岸帶生態(tài)功能低下等問題。為此,本文以濕地公園岸帶為研究對象,以維護(hù)與增強(qiáng)岸帶生物多樣性為主要目標(biāo),提出滿足生態(tài)需求和社會需求的多種濕地公園岸帶岸帶空間設(shè)計方式。本文首先對影響濕地公園岸帶空間生物多樣性的因素進(jìn)行分析,總結(jié)出以下濕地公園岸帶空間設(shè)計的基本思路。1.在進(jìn)行濕地公園岸帶空間配置過程中,選擇植被物種時,盡量不選擇具有相同生態(tài)位的物種,避免種群之間強(qiáng)烈性競爭,使得群落趨于穩(wěn)定。2.在相對穩(wěn)定的植被群落中,盡量選擇各自生態(tài)位不同的植被。植被的生態(tài)位要素包括:水位高差、種群密度、種群個體數(shù)、植被配置的時間、空間位置等多個方面。3.由多個種群組成的生態(tài)系統(tǒng)要比由單一種群組成的生態(tài)系統(tǒng)穩(wěn)定,因此進(jìn)行岸帶植被配置時應(yīng)該盡量選擇多樣的物種進(jìn)行搭配種植。4.基于對邊緣效應(yīng)生態(tài)學(xué)意義的理解,在濕地公園岸帶的設(shè)計與改造過程中,應(yīng)逐漸開拓對邊緣效應(yīng)的認(rèn)識,在地理位置、動物棲息地環(huán)境營造、人為影響、景觀性質(zhì)與斑塊破碎化程度等方面應(yīng)提高重視度。其次,本研究依據(jù)濕地水深、水流速度、岸帶形式三個要素將岸帶歸納為六種岸帶類型,分別為靜水深水型、靜水淺水型、深水凸岸性、深水凹岸型、淺水凸岸性、淺水凹岸型。并將每種岸帶類型元素組成劃分為自然與人文元素,自然元素內(nèi)容包括濕地植物配置、水文特征、基質(zhì)的組成,人文元素包括岸帶設(shè)施元素以及濃厚的文化元素。其中,設(shè)施元素部分基于不同的岸帶類型介紹了四種生態(tài)護(hù)岸形式,包括拋石護(hù)岸、木樁護(hù)岸、石籠護(hù)岸、礫石網(wǎng)筒護(hù)岸,文化元素部分介紹了木棧道、觀景平臺、碼頭、廊道等人類文化設(shè)施。再次,本文基于動植物棲息地、人類游憩休閑和科研宣教等不同需要,對濕地公園岸帶空間元素進(jìn)行配置組合,提出不同岸帶類型的設(shè)計模式。最后,文章以北京市平谷區(qū)小龍河濕地公園為主要案例改造對象,通過對岸帶軟硬質(zhì)分析、植物配置分析、護(hù)坡類型分析、動物棲息地分析、人文元素等的分析,剖析目前小龍河濕地公園岸帶空間面臨的問題,提出在植物配置與分布、護(hù)坡類型及其分布、動物棲息地改造等方面的建議,最后做出基于保護(hù)岸帶空間的設(shè)計方案,總結(jié)出針對濕地公園岸帶空間設(shè)計的經(jīng)驗與方法。以期為之后的濕地公園岸帶空間設(shè)計指導(dǎo)方向。
[Abstract]:Wetland park is a new pattern of harmonious development of wetland protection and comprehensive utilization in recent years, and its design theory and practice are not perfect. At present, in the design of wetland park shore space, more and more landscape water body design ideas have been used, resulting in the lack of wetland plant species, coastal material and energy exchange is not smooth, the low ecological function of the coastal zone and so on. Therefore, this paper takes the coastal zone of wetland park as the research object, with the main goal of maintaining and enhancing the biodiversity of the coastal zone, and puts forward a variety of spatial design methods of the coastal zone of wetland park to meet the ecological and social needs. In this paper, the factors affecting the spatial biodiversity of wetland park shore zone are analyzed, and the basic ideas of the following wetland park shore zone space design are summarized. In the process of spatial allocation of coastal zone in wetland park, the species with the same niche should not be selected as far as possible when selecting vegetation species, so as to avoid strong competition among populations and make the community tend to be stable. In the relatively stable vegetation community, choose the vegetation with different niche as far as possible. The niche elements of vegetation include: water level difference, population density, population individual number, time of vegetation allocation, spatial location and so on. 3. The ecosystem composed of multiple populations is more stable than that made up of a single population. Therefore, various species should be chosen as far as possible for the allocation of coastal vegetation. 4. Based on the understanding of the ecological significance of the edge effect, in the course of the design and transformation of the coastal zone of the wetland park, we should gradually develop the understanding of the edge effect, create the environment of the animal habitat and man-made influence in the geographical position, the animal habitat and the environment. Attention should be paid to landscape properties and patch fragmentation. Secondly, according to the three factors of wetland water depth, flow velocity and coastal zone form, the coastal zone can be classified into six types, namely, static water deep water type, static water shallow water type, deep water bulge type, deep water concave bank type, shallow water protruding type, and so on, which can be divided into six types: static water deep water type, static water shallow water type, deep water protruding type, Shallow water concave bank type. The elements of each type of coastal zone are divided into natural and human elements. The natural elements include wetland plant configuration, hydrological characteristics, matrix composition, cultural elements including coastal facilities elements and strong cultural elements. Among them, four kinds of ecological revetment forms are introduced based on different types of shoreline, including boulder bank protection, wooden pile bank protection, stone cage bank protection, gravel net bank protection, cultural element part introduces wooden trestle road, viewing platform, wharf. Human cultural facilities such as corridors. Thirdly, based on the different needs of animal and plant habitat, human recreation and scientific research, this paper combines the spatial elements of the coastal zone of wetland park, and puts forward the design patterns of different types of coastal zones. Finally, the paper takes Xiaolong River Wetland Park in Pinggu District of Beijing as the main case, through the analysis of soft and hard in the opposite shore zone, the analysis of plant configuration, the analysis of slope protection type, the analysis of animal habitat, the analysis of human elements, and so on. This paper analyzes the problems faced by the coastal space of Xiaolong River Wetland Park at present, puts forward some suggestions in the aspects of plant allocation and distribution, slope protection type and distribution, animal habitat transformation, etc., and finally makes a design scheme based on the protected coastal space. This paper summarizes the experiences and methods in the design of the coastal zone of wetland park. In order to guide the design of the coastal zone of wetland park.
